Output f76a8ce9a01f53bc069b56321b1a8a74162f5997102caf97a26642911e257afe: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58af38431724e8be4d00364bc7ac40a4f35d13ea OP_EQUAL
address
39mwHudF1E1rgMQSw86SAhpRBDxPbNk7ao
transaction
f76a8ce9a01f53bc069b56321b1a8a74162f5997102caf97a26642911e257afe
spent
true